Introduction to Real Estate Investing
Real estate investing is a great way to build wealth and generate passive income. It involves purchasing, owning, managing, renting, and/or selling real estate for profit. Benefits of Real Estate Investing
There are several benefits to investing in real estate:
- Income Generation: Rental properties can provide a steady stream of income.
- Appreciation: Real estate tends to increase in value over time.
- Tax Benefits: Investors can take advantage of tax deductions and incentives.
- Diversification: Real estate can diversify your investment portfolio.
Types of Real Estate Investments
There are different ways to invest in real estate:
1. Rental Properties
Investing in rental properties involves purchasing a property and renting it out to tenants. You can generate passive income through monthly rent payments.
2. Fix-and-Flip
Fix-and-flip involves purchasing a property, renovating it, and selling it for a profit. This strategy requires some hands-on work but can be lucrative.
3.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s)
REITs are companies that own, operate, or finance income-producing real estate. Investing in REITs allows you to invest in real estate without directly owning properties.

Real Estate Investing Tips for Beginners
Here are some tips to help beginners succeed in real estate investing:
1. Research the Market
Understand the local real estate market, including property values, rental rates, and market trends. Conduct thorough research before making any investment decisions.
2. Calculate Your Expenses
Factor in all expenses, such as property taxes, insurance, maintenance costs, and vacancy rates. Make sure to budget accordingly to avoid financial surprises.
3. Consider Financing Options
Explore different financing options, such as mortgages, loans, or partnerships. Choose the option that best fits your financial situation and investment goals.
4. Develop a Realistic Investment Strategy
Set clear investment objectives and develop a strategy that aligns with your goals. Whether you’re looking for short-term profits or long-term growth, having a plan in place is essential.

Q: What are some common mistakes to avoid in real estate investing?
A: Some common mistakes to avoid in real estate investing include overleveraging, underestimating expenses, neglecting due diligence, and not having a clear investment strategy. It’s important for beginners to do their research, seek advice from professionals, and make informed decisions.
